  • 19th of April Movement - Wikipedia
    The 19th of April Movement (Spanish: Movimiento 19 de Abril), or M-19, was a Colombian urban guerrilla movement active in the late 1970s and 1980s After its demobilization in 1990, it became a political party, the M-19 Democratic Alliance (Alianza Democrática M-19), or AD M-19
  • M-19 | Members, Leaders, Bolivar Sword | Britannica
    Unlike other existing Colombian guerrilla groups, the M-19 was urban-oriented The M-19 eschewed international (e g , Soviet, Chinese, and Cuban) revolutionary models in favour of a socialist ideology grounded in Colombia’s own history

  • M-19 | Colombia Reports
    On the 6th of November 1985, members of the M-19 seized the Palace of Justice in Bogota They took hundreds of hostages, including 25 Supreme Court judges Over the next two days, the army hatched a plan to retake the Palace

  • The April 19 Movement (M-19)
    The April 19 Movement (M-19) was formed in 1974 by Jaime Bateman Cayón, Antonio Navarro Wolff, and Carlos Toledo Plata to fight for democracy in Colombia The M-19 was most known for its attacks on multinational corporations and embassies
  • Cascon Case COL: Colombia (M-19) 1974-90 - MIT
    On February 27 1980 M-19 raided an Embassy reception, holding 52 hostages including ambassadors under siege for 61 days of negotiations The guerrillas then flew to Cuba with ransom money and the promise of an international commission to monitor human rights
  • M-19 | Encyclopedia. com
    Active from 1974 to 1990, the M-19 guerrilla group was an offshoot of the National Popular Alliance (ANAPO) of former dictator Gustavo Rojas Pinilla; its name comes from the date in 1970 when electoral fraud allegedly deprived him of the presidency
